在Xamarin開發中,UWP環境下無法進入斷點調試standard庫的問題解決方案

環境如下

選擇的代碼共享方案爲standard模式

再多平臺依賴注入的時候,斷點一直提示沒有加載文檔。

進入到目標平臺項目Debug文件夾下,查看。發現standard庫引用進來後,對應的*.pdb文件飛車小。這個文件是debug必須要有的文件,照理說會比對應的dll文件更大,畢竟裏面裝的是調試信息

看看目標平臺的pdb文件就可以看出,明顯是生成的時候有問題

但是這個問題怎麼解決呢?其實也很簡單,在standard的項目右鍵->屬性->生成->高級->調試信息->選擇 ‘僅PDB’

然後再次運行

完美進入斷點

昨晚折騰到四五點才找到這個解決方案,希望能幫助到後面學習遇到這個問題的同學

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章